What does a predictive dialer in the cloud do?

A cloud predictive dialer is a new kind of technology that makes calls and works in the cloud. Cloud-based systems work over the internet, but classic on-premise dialers need a lot of equipment. This makes it easier to reach, less expensive, and more flexible for businesses of all sizes.

It can make forecasts thanks to its powerful algorithms. You don’t have to call each number one at a time because the dialler tells you how many agents will be accessible and how quickly clients will answer. After that, it makes a bunch of calls at once and only connects agents when someone answers. Businesses should get rid of missed calls, voicemails, and busy signals to be as effective as possible.

Why the Cloud Predictive Dialler Is the Best Option

1. The ability to adapt and evolve

With a cloud predictive dialer, businesses may modify the size of their operations based on how many calls they get. Whether you run a small business or a major call center, the cloud enables you to grow your business without having to buy expensive equipment.

2. Talking to people without spending a lot of money

Businesses don’t have to pay for infrastructure, maintenance, or IT support because it’s all on the cloud. Small businesses can also utilize it easily and cheaply because the fee is based on a subscription.

3. Getting to it from a long way away

You can use a cloud predictive dialer on any computer or phone that is connected to the internet. This is wonderful for folks who work from home or in different places because it enables you to chat with each other no matter where you are.

4. More work gets done

If agents don’t have to dial numbers and hang up on calls that aren’t useful, they could talk to more individuals. This helps sales teams close more deals and makes everyone work harder.

5. Protecting and making sure data is reliable

Cloud services keep your data safe by encrypting it, which is a pretty new technique to do it. Regular backups and updates protect consumer data and make sure that ways to talk to each other work smoothly.
